The PDK Java API is part of the Portal Developer Kit on Portal Studio

oracle.portal.provider.v2.webservice
Class XMLStringWebServiceRenderer

java.lang.Object
  |
  +--oracle.portal.provider.v2.render.ManagedRenderer
        |
        +--oracle.portal.provider.v2.render.http.BaseManagedRenderer
              |
              +--oracle.portal.provider.v2.webservice.WebServiceRenderer
                    |
                    +--oracle.portal.provider.v2.webservice.RPCWebServiceRenderer
                          |
                          +--oracle.portal.provider.v2.webservice.XMLStringWebServiceRenderer
All Implemented Interfaces:
InitializableXMLObject, Validateable

public class XMLStringWebServiceRenderer
extends RPCWebServiceRenderer

XMLStringWebServiceRenderer is a specialized RPCWebServiceRenderer for invoking 'RPC style' web services that return XML as a string. XMLStringWebServiceRenderer extends oracle.portal.provider.v2.webservice.RPCWebserviceRenderer. If the response contains xml in string form, then the string is expanded to XML. Otherwise, if the response contains other data types, the control is delegated to the super class.


Inner classes inherited from class oracle.portal.provider.v2.webservice.WebServiceRenderer
WebServiceRenderer.ConstParam, WebServiceRenderer.DefaultableParameterBinding, WebServiceRenderer.EditData, WebServiceRenderer.ParameterBinding, WebServiceRenderer.PromptedBinding, WebServiceRenderer.RequestParam, WebServiceRenderer.SessionAttrib, WebServiceRenderer.URLParam
 
Constructor Summary
XMLStringWebServiceRenderer()
           
 
Methods inherited from class oracle.portal.provider.v2.webservice.RPCWebServiceRenderer
addParam, addParam, invokeService, postInitialize, setClassName, setRenderMethod
 
Methods inherited from class oracle.portal.provider.v2.webservice.WebServiceRenderer
addLiteral, getBindings, getEscapeOutput, getLiteral, getLogging, getLoggingDirectory, renderBody, renderEdit, renderEditDefaults, renderLink, renderShow, setEscapeOutput, setLogging, setLoggingDirectory, setResponseXSL, validate
 
Methods inherited from class oracle.portal.provider.v2.render.http.BaseManagedRenderer
addParameter, getContentType, getGeneratesESI, preInitialize, prepareResponse, setContentType, setGeneratesESI, setGeneratesESI, setPageExpires, setPageExpires, setUseInvalidationCaching, setUseInvalidationCaching
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

XMLStringWebServiceRenderer

public XMLStringWebServiceRenderer()

The PDK Java API is part of the Portal Developer Kit on Portal Studio

Copyright (c) 2002, Oracle Corporation. All Rights Reserved.